Luvsurf TV:LOST 『V2-GRINDER』Kei Kobayashi Rider: Kei Kobayashi Board used: LOST 『V2-GRINDER』POLYESTER FILM: Koji Nishii EDIT: TABRIGADE FILM This board is a tuned-up version of the V2-SB by MAYHEM to be able to ride in smaller waves. Below is a description of the board released by MAYHEM. Short and wide... super fast. The V2-Grinder is a V2-SB that's been expanded to be rounder and thicker. I first made it for some local friends of mine who said, "I used to be a good surfer, almost at a professional level, but then I grew up, got a job, had kids, and now I surf easy beach breaks with my kids whenever I get the chance." We received rave reviews from our old local heroes and were so happy that we offered it to some WCT and QS competitors to ride. The result is a board that's a contest machine in very small waves, and with Carissa Moore and other world-class surfers getting great results on it in less than stellar conditions, we decided to include it in our lineup. It combines the V2's signature low entry and pronounced tail lift with a classic Sub Scorcher-like outline. The wide tail block provides drive, lift, and a stable platform in flat conditions. The short rail line and ample tail lift (combined with the generous rail) still keeps it in the water and allows for small, tight, quick turns, even in shorebreaks.
